Bruce McKenna

Bruce C. McKenna (born March 14, 1962 at Englewood Hospital) is a writer for television and film. He is the Emmy Award-winning co-executive producer, creator, principal writer and researcher on the 2010 HBO 10 part mini-series, The Pacific, which was co-produced by Steven Spielberg and Tom Hanks.
